Area:Usk
Beat:Glan-yr-Afon
Fishing:Trout (River)
No. of Anglers:1
Beautiful beat good access ,started at top of beat and worked down .Water was quite fast flowing so needed to be careful. Eventually caught one around 8" on a nymph then missed one. Ended up by pool by the bridge with a few fishing rising lost two more to size 20 parachute Adams. Had a great day hopefully return later this week with the water a bit lower for round 2
1 Trout

Area:Usk
Beat:Glan-yr-Afon
Fishing:Trout (River)
No. of Anglers:1
One of my favourite beats as long as you come on a quiet week day. Steady fishing using double nymphing, Duo and Dry. The best fish was a very solid 18” the others went 17”, 16”, 13”, 2 x 12”,10”.”
7 Trout

Area:Usk
Beat:Glan-yr-Afon
Fishing:Trout (River)
No. of Anglers:1
3 trout all around the 1lb mark , but very hard fighting fish. Lost a slightly better trout on the dry and briefly hooked another 3 with nymphs. Low water made trout a bit spooky during the day, and the public footpath doesn’t get very busy( saw only a few people all day ) which is a massive bonus
3 Trout
